Programme Structure
|
|
|
|
The MS Programme has a flexible
structure and can accommodate students with
varied backgrounds. The period of study for
this programme for a particular person depends
on the individual's prior education and experience.
Students holding degrees in Computer Science
(CS), Computer Engineering (CMPE) and related
studies can complete the programme requirements
in less than two years. However, such students
will need to produce course descriptions from
their previous study in order to get waivers
for prerequisite courses. A person with a non-CS/CMPE
background may have to spend additional time
in completing prerequisite courses; the duration,
in this case, will depend on the nature of prior
courses taken. |

MS Computer
Science |
|
|
|
The MS in
CS programme aims at developing professionals
who are equipped with skills to cope with the
diverse and ever changing field of Computer
Science. The programme provides students with
a solid theoretical foundation along with knowledge
of latest trends in specialized areas. |
|
|
|
The two-year MS Programme
provides rigorous training that not only provides
a reliable understanding of systems and processes
and technologies but also equips them with the
ability to design new and imaginative solutions
to problems. Those applicants who have a background
in Computer Science can complete the programme
in one-year by taking the required 45 units. |

MS Computer
Engineering |
|
|
|
The MS Computer
Engineering programme has been designed to produce
specialized professionals who can perform cutting
edge research in selected areas of the field.
The aim is to train students to become technical
leaders of industry possessing excellent IT
management skills or to become competent teachers. |

Strengths of the MS Programme |
|
|
- A Solid theoretical foundation is ensured
through the core courses and prerequisite
requirements.
- Ability to understand the theoretical
basis of problem-solving
- Concentrated knowledge about latest trends
in specialized areas
- Theoretical Computer Science
- Artificial Intelligence
- Information Engineering & Management
- Networks and Distributed Systems
- Multimedia Systems and DSP
- Ability to understand and apply current
research in these areas
- Technical management skills
- Flexibility to focus on one area
- Wide range of course offerings
- High quality full time faculty, active
in research
- Opportunity to work as research assistants
with the faculty
- Opportunity to continue into the PhD programme,
upon clearing the Qualifier Exam
